Brian Needham Posted February 9, 2013 Report Share Posted February 9, 2013 Ok, weird question maybe to some but I wonder this: ok say you got an active 3 way set up front . say rainbow profi kicks, the minimum RMS is 75, the RMS 125, and max is 150. and lets say you are running a ZED 6 ch amp which is 190x6. how would you set the final settings of gain with a DD-1........I ask because I am assuming that if you "set it and forget it" with the DD1 you might be running WAY too much power to the speaker, especially the tweets and mids. ya don't want to blow something up... How do you know what the "watt output" using the DD1. or does it even matter? meade916 Posted February 9, 2013 Report Share Posted February 9, 2013 if your mids/highs are being overpowered, use a different gain overlap track. i can put a 1500 watt amp on a 500 watt woofer and be just fine, at maximum deck power, using the -5 track.
